Amazon have released a new firmware update for their V2 and DX Kindles, adding better battery management, native PDF reader support and screen rotation capability to the International Kindle.
It’s not available over here yet, but Amazon have announced that an international version of their 9.7″ eBook Reader, the Kindle DX, will be available “sometime next year”. Just as a guide, the US Kindle DX sells for $489, while a 6″ International Kindle sells for $259. There’s likely to be a small premium on the International version of the FX, so it might be expected to retail at $509 or so.
